I got this recipe from my grandmother. I usually make it for company potlucks and big event because it make a lot of cinnamon rolls. Ingredients:
2 1/2 cups warm water |
4 1/2 teaspoons yeast |
1 (18 1/2 ounce) box yellow cake mix |
6 1/4 cups flour |
3 eggs |
1/3 cup vegetable oil |
1 teaspoon salt |
1 cup margarine |
2 cups brown sugar |
16 teaspoons ground cinnamon |
8 ounces cream cheese |
1/4 cup margarine |
2 -3 teaspoons milk |
1 teaspoon vanilla |
4 cups powdered sugar |
Directions:
1. Dissolve yeast in water for 3 minuted then add cake mix, 1 cup of flour, eggs, oil and salt. Beat until bubbles appear. 2. Slowly add remaining flour. Stir with spoon making soft dough. Knead for about 5 minutes. 3. Place in greased bowl, and let rise for about 30 minutes or until doubled in size. 4. Punch down and roll out onto floured surface to 1/3 inch thickness. Spread margarine on dough and ad sugar and cinnamon. Rolls up jelly rolls style and cut. 5. Fits about 12 cinnamon rolls per 13 x 9 cassarols pan. 6. Bake 350 for 20-30 minutes. 7. Beat cream cheese, margarine, milk and vanilla until smooth. 8. Gradually add powdered sugar until well blended. 9. Spread over cinnamon rolls. |
